Default 2 days of 6+ Stingray deliveries with pictures and stories. Mike@Criswell

I was off Friday but I knew Richard and Marilynn of Lancaster, PA had a small window Friday to take delivery. His last Corvette was a 1961 model yr when he was 18...things have changed a bit. So they came down at 11am and drove their stunning Crystal Red Metallic C7 Z51 cpe home in record time.












Next up David F from Houston received his Arctic White Z51 cpe down in Houston. In his own words...
"It is an impressive car. The last corvette I owned was a 1999 Fixed Roof Coupe, and I have owned dozens of other cars since then. Many performance cars, but not many manual transmissions. The last manual was a 2010 Audi R8 V10. The rev match feature seems really fun, and the sound of the performance exhaust is awesome.

Plycar delivered last night while we were at dinner with our 3 daughters and 2 other families. While I was outside taking delivery, one the guys asked my wife "so he is really having a car delivered right now?" My wife replied "yea, this isn't the first time that has happened. You notice I don't even get up to see any of the action." "

Catch you later,
Dave F Houston, TX





~Then the paperwork arrived from Greg C of Nipomo, CA. His Stingray should arrive any day at his local Chevrolet dealer for a courtesy delivery.

~And down at the Corvette Museum Robert D of Las Vegas, NV was picking up his Z51 after too many months of working over seas. Pictures to follow in another post.

~Then Roger H and his wife of Discovery Bay, CA rec'd his paperwork even though he is vacationing in Hawaii. Upon his return he will make a trip to the Museum to get his new Stingray!

~Above was all Friday...below is Saturday from 8:45am-1pm.

Geoff B of Mechanicsburg met me at the dealership bright and early to pick up his Stingray Z51 cpe in Cyber Gray with 3LT Brownstone interior. He traded in his Audi...and roared away in his C7.











~20 minutes after Geoff arrived up pulled Jayson W from Ashburn, VA. Jayson had seen this C7 on our web site and put in an internet request to me about it. He traded in his beloved 2005 Cpe for a Black Stingray with yellow calipers...and it is sharp! He couldn't believe the differences in the two vehicles...night and day.







~At 10am while Geoff and Jayson were finishing up the paperwork in the business office...up pulls Jim B from Baltimore, MD. He put in an internet request the night before and I answered him at 8:22am...he had already departed for Criswell. Jim still owns his 1973 Corvette but got rid of his '98 vette long ago... So I got his 2000 Jaguar Convt appraised and he started the delivery process for a new 2014 Stingray cpe in Silver with Red interior that he picked out of our inventory. Happy Birthday Jim!!









~Of course my 11am apt showed up right on time. Al C and his wife drove up from Woodbridge, VA to pick up their factory order Laguna Blue with Kalahari Z51 cpe. Al traded in his 2007 Yellow cpe and could not have been happier with his C7 order.
